Term | Definition |
Atrium | Two upper chambers of the heart that contract at the same time during heat beat. |
Ventricle | Two lower chambers of the heart that contract at the same time during a heart beat. |
Coronary Circulation | Flow of blood to and from the tissuse of the heart. |
Pulmonary Circulation | Flow of blood through the heart to the lungs and back to the heart. |
Systemic Circulation | Largest part of the circulatory system, in which oxygen-rich blood flows to ALL the organs and body tissues, except the heart, lungs; oxygen-poor blood is returned to the heart. |
Artery | Blood vessel that carries blood AWAY from the heart and has thick, elastic walls made of connective tissue and smooth muscle tissue. |
Vein | Blood vessel that carries blood BACK TO the heart, and has one-way valves that keep blood moving TOWARD the heart. |
Capillary | Microsopic blood vessel that connects arteries and veins, has walls one-cell thick, through which nurtrients and oxygen diffuse INTO body cells, and wastse materials and carbon dioxide diffuse Out of body cells. |
